2020-11-29 22:43 阅读 0

Eden Warp

I noticed when i went into a room a part of the warps dident work. is about this part i linked below.

moc_para01,49,86,0  script  #warp_2_pass_1  WARPNPC,1,1,{
    warp "moc_para01",103,27;


The Fix what i did is replace the ontouch just for warp.

moc_para01,57,27,0  warp    #warp_2_pub 1,1,moc_para01,162,26
moc_para01,158,26,0 warp    #warp_2_din_1   1,1,moc_para01,55,27
moc_para01,48,16,0  warp    #warp_2_2f  1,1,moc_para01,48,164
moc_para01,47,161,0 warp    #warp_2_1f  1,1,moc_para01,47,18
moc_para01,107,12,0 warp    #warp_2_din_2   1,1,moc_para01,47,37
moc_para01,100,27,0 warp    #warp_2_gym 1,1,moc_para01,47,85
moc_para01,49,86,0  warp    #warp_2_pass_1  1,1,moc_para01,103,27
moc_para01,113,32,0 warp    #warp_2_ware    1,1,moc_para01,105,92
moc_para01,102,92,0 warp    #warp_2_pass_2  1,1,moc_para01,109,33
moc_para01,41,187,0 warp    #warp_2_room2   1,1,moc_para01,179,93
moc_para01,179,90,0 warp    #warp_2_2fhall_3    1,1,moc_para01,41,185

Kind Regards Henry


  • weixin_39632379 weixin_39632379 2020-11-29 22:43

    Strange enough I was able to confirm this with #warp_2_pass_1, but most of the others are working. Why did we not use warp type npcs here anyway?

  • weixin_39825872 weixin_39825872 2020-11-29 22:43

    Hello there,

    This issue also reflects to HazeyForest & OGH which causes the warp portals not to work over there.

    Yours Faithfully, RDash

  • weixin_39929721 weixin_39929721 2020-11-29 22:43

    i'm about to report this... but then i saw this.

  • weixin_39844942 weixin_39844942 2020-11-29 22:43

    On rAthena every player's step, npc_touch_areanpc triggers the first npc load by server in the area, others npcs in range won't be triggered (except defined warp) https://github.com/rathena/rathena/blob/master/src/map/npc.c#L983

    For example loading #warp_2_pass_1 before https://github.com/rathena/rathena/blob/master/npc/re/quests/eden/eden_121_130.txt#L555 will solve the issue for this case.

    Differences rathena / aegis : - queue event system on aegis (trigger the second script after the end of the first under conditions). On rathena it run only the first script in range load by the server - on rathena players stop walking when a script is triggered, not on aegis


  • weixin_39613548 weixin_39613548 2020-11-29 22:43

    same i came across it as well. I can confirm

